stakeholder pension
- IPA[ˈsteɪkhəʊldə pɛnʃn]
英式
- (in the UK) a pension plan, intended primarily for those who do not belong to a company pension scheme or who are self-employed, which invests the money a person saves and uses the fund on retirement to buy a pension from a pension provider.
noun: stakeholder pension, plural noun: stakeholder pensions
